There are many ways to get to the Bloomington-Normal area! Our central location makes it easy to travel by plane, train or automobile.
The Central Illinois Regional Airport in Bloomington-Normal has everything you need and more in an airport. In addition to air service to every corner of the globe, the Central Illinois Regional Airport offers free parking, a shuttle service, five car rental agencies inside the terminal (Hertz, Avis, National, Budget and Alamo), and two convenient dining options.
Amtrak also services Bloomington-Normal on a daily basis with stops at the Bloomington-Normal (BNL) station located on E. Parkinson Street, just a few steps from Uptown Normal. Travel to and from Bloomington-Normal with ease on either the Illinois or Texas Eagle Service. For time and rate information please check Amtrak.com.
A third transportation option is to travel to the twin cities by bus. Burlington Trailways, Greyhound Bus Lines, Megabus, and the Peoria Charter Coach all operate daily bus routes through Bloomington-Normal. For times, rates, and to make reservations please check with the individual bus companies.
